Narrative:A Robinson R22 Beta helicopter with an instructor and student on board, crashed in the Tietê Ecological Park - São Paulo, during an attempted forced landing. None of the occupants suffered injuries. According to a rough translation into English of contemporary press reports (see link #5 for original Brazilian text):
"Helicopter crashes in SP East Zone
On 9 May 2013 14:08
Two teams from the Fire Department went to Tiete Ecological Park.
Until 14:40 Thursday (9), there were no reports of injuries.
A helicopter crashed on Thursday afternoon at the Tietê Ecological Park on the Ayrton Senna Highway in the eastern part of the capital. The two passengers suffered minor injuries.
The helicopter is private, a Beta R22 of the Robinson Helicopter company, prefixed, PT-HPK, and was used for pilot training. There was in the vehicle an instructor and a student of the JR Helicopters company, based at Campo de Marte. The pilot suffered a cut in the head, but, like the student, he is well.
Erinaldo Melo, the company's chief financial officer, said that because of a crash that has not yet been clarified, the pilot made a hard landing. The helicopter fell on its right side and, according to Melo, suffered only superficial damage. He also said that both the pilot and the school are fully documented and that the student was properly enrolled. In a statement, the company said the helicopter underwent a survey by the National Civil Aviation Agency (ANAC) yesterday, May 8.
"We have already notified all the competent bodies and have made available a mechanic to find out what happened," said Melo. The company's operations manager is also checking which procedures will be taken on the aircraft, which was purchased by the company in January last year.
Two Fire Department vehicles were sent to the scene at 2:21 pm, but because there were no serious victims, they did not file the case. According to the corporation, it will be up to the company responsible for the helicopter to remove it from the crash site.
Melo said JR Helicopters is awaiting authorisation from the Air Force's Research and Accident Prevention Center (Cenipa) and expects to remove it from the site by 10 pm today, 9 pm, with a helicopter transport truck .
According to Anac data, the aircraft has a valid airworthiness certificate (CA) until 2016. Its annual maintenance inspection (IAM) is valid until March 2014."
